The Office of International Education at the University at Buffalo invites applications for the position of Assistant Director, Asia Research Institute (ARI)<https://www.buffalo.edu/asiainstitute.html>. Reporting to the Institute Director, the Assistant Director plays a key leadership role in managing the Institute's academic, administrative and outreach activities.

The Assistant Director will:

  *   Plan and coordinate Institute academic and cultural programs, in collaboration with the Institute Director, affiliated faculty and Institute staff.
  *   Manage program logistics and activities, coordinate administrative approvals; oversee / provide direct support for conferences, lectures, and other Institute initiatives.
  *   Develop proposals for Institute initiatives and projects in cooperation with Institute leadership; liaise with external funding agencies and representatives, and prepare project reports.
  *   Prepare budget requests and budget reports, provide fiscal oversight for institute accounts. Support the Institute Director in cultivating potential donors.
  *   Manage the Institute's website, calendar, and listservs; oversee communications, marketing, and publicity efforts.
  *   Supervise Institute personnel, including professional staff, student assistants, and short-term program assistants.

Minimum Qualifications
Bachelor's degree, and five years of directly related work experience; or an equivalent combination of education and experience.

Experience to include:

  *   Administrative experience related to externally funded or fee-based programs
  *   Supervisory experience or a demonstrated ability to establish priorities for work to be accomplished by others
  *   Event management
  *   Superior coordination and interpersonal skills
  *   Excellent verbal and written communication skills, including an ability to present complex ideas in a clear, concise written format

Preferred Qualifications

  *   A degree in a field related to the Asia Research Institute's academic activities is preferred.
  *   An advanced degree is preferred.
